Provincial impacts


If an allowable annual cut determination is made consistent with the base case, it is estimated that during the first 20 years, annual provincial employment, employment income and government revenues associated with the Bulkley Timber Supply Area harvest would remain at current levels. However, they could begin to decline after 20 years. Ninety years from now, when the long-term timber supply is reached, government revenues could drop by about 50 per cent to $9.6 million annually (SEA page 35). As stated earlier, these estimates do not include increased stumpage revenues from the recently announced Forest Renewal Plan.
